The average time for residential roof repair projects in Los Angeles varies based on the specific scope of work and the severity of the damage. According to Roofland, INC., project timelines generally follow three categories:

Minor repairs, such as fixing isolated leaks or tile adjustments, typically take 1 to 2 days to complete.

Moderate damage, which may involve repairing multiple shingles, usually requires between 2 and 4 days.

Extensive projects, including widespread flashing repair or more complex restoration, can take from 3 to 5 days.

Several factors can influence these durations, including the overall size of the roof, ease of access to the site, current weather conditions, and the availability of specific materials. The repair process itself follows a structured sequence that includes surface preparation, material application using weather-resistant products, sealing vulnerabilities, and final layering for protection.
